As a part of the broader Australian Steel Products portfolio, we have six major manufacturing sites at Port Kembla that deliver a variety of products, innovative solutions and services to our export and domestic customers.

Due to several exciting projects and opportunities that have allowed some of our people to step into new roles, we now have **three Asset Manager** vacancies available
- **Energy Services Asset Manager**, **Slab Caster Asset Manager** and **Steel Treatment and Slabmaking Services Asset Manager**.

Our Slabmaking department processes iron into steel slabs for the domestic and international markets. We’ve got a large asset base here so it’s important these are optimised - now and into the future.

Our Energy services department is critical to the entire Manufacturing site, the team provide energy and critical utilities essential to keep the plant operating on a 24/7 basis.
